The Museum of Power is a unique and fascinating experience & is located at Langford, near Maldon, Essex.

Set in seven acres of grounds with the River Blackwater running through, exhibits are housed in the 1920s Steam Pumping Station, the former generator hall and boiler house which was originally designed to provide a daily supply of seven million gallons of drinking water which together with the existing wells, met anticipated demand until the 1960's.

The video features events on the 26th June 2011, with the East Essex Heavy Horse show in attendance & the Classic cars from the TR Drivers Club.

The 7 ¼" Gauge Miniature Railway main line has a journey of over ¼ of a mile through the seven acres of mature woods and meadows that make up the museum grounds. A small halt, RIVERSIDE, is situated beside the footpath from the visitors car park to the Museum but the main station, LANGFORD, is on the east side of the railway not many yards from the original Langford Station on the Maldon Witham Branch (axed in the 60s).
